Legal Analysis of Passive Euthanasia under Indonesian Health Law

Abstract

Introduction: Passive euthanasia, which involves withholding or withdrawing life-prolonging medical treatments, remains a highly controversial issue within the Indonesian legal landscape. While the medical community increasingly confronts situations where life support seems futile, the legal framework often appears ambiguous or overly restrictive. Methods: This research employs a normative juridical legal method, analyzing statutory provisions, judicial precedents, and doctrinal theories to evaluate the current legal status of passive euthanasia in Indonesia. Results: The study reveals a significant legislative gap between traditional criminal prohibitions and the evolving realities of modern medical practice. While the Indonesian Criminal Code strictly penalizes active forms of life-terminating acts, contemporary health regulations provide fragmented acknowledgments of the right to refuse treatment, leading to acute legal uncertainty for healthcare professionals. Discussion: The discussion synthesizes constitutional rights, medical ethics, and comparative law, highlighting that the lack of clear, standardized operational guidelines for passive euthanasia forces a reliance on judicial interpretation that may conflict with the patient's right to self-determination and the physician's duty of care. Conclusions: In conclusion, Indonesian health law requires comprehensive statutory refinement to explicitly regulate passive euthanasia, balancing human rights, cultural values, and medical necessities. The study recommends the immediate enactment of specific guidelines concerning advanced medical directives to provide clear legal protection for both patients and medical practitioners.
